The 2023 Rolls-Royce Phantom is sold in the U.S. as a gas large car with 2 EPA-rated configurations. The most efficient version, the Phantom, is EPA-rated at 14 mpg combined. NHTSA lists 1 recall campaign for this model year, which gives it a Safety Signal grade of A.

ProblemBMW of North America, LLC (BMW) is recalling certain 2023 Rolls-Royce Phantom vehicles. The headlights may not have received a metal coating application, which can result in the low beams not adequately illuminating road signs.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ard number 108, "Lamps, Reflective Devices, and Associated Devices."RiskImproperly illuminated road signs may be difficult for the driver to read, increasing the risk of a crash.FixDealers will replace the headlights, free of charge. The affected vehicles are still at dealerships and therefore no owner notification letters will be mailed. Owners may contact Rolls-Royce customer service at 1-877-877-3735.

Sources & method

Safety Signal starts every model-year at 100 and subtracts points per open NHTSA recall campaign by severity: critical 15 (fire risk, park-outside or do-not-drive advisories), high 8 (brakes, steering, airbags, loss of drive power, structure, battery), moderate 6, minor 3 (software, labels, lighting fixed by an update). Floor 35. A ≥ 90, B ≥ 80, C ≥ 70, D ≥ 60, otherwise F. Complaint counts and NHTSA crash ratings are shown separately and are not blended into the grade.

EPA figures come from fueleconomy.gov vehicle records. Recalls, complaints, investigations and crash ratings come from NHTSA's public flat files, refreshed weekly.
